An Abakaliki based Legal Practitioner Barrister Iheanacho Agboti, on Thursday restated that the leadership of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) lacks the legitimate Right/Powers under the the Trade Union (Amendment) Act 2005, to sanction the Management of Federal University of Technology (FUTO) Owerri over alleged infraction.
Barrister Agboti made the assertion in Abakiliki the Ebonyi State capital while reacting to the threat by ASUU to suspend the management of the ivory Tower over the professorship it conferred to the Minister of Communications and Digital Economy Professor Isa Ali Pantami.
The Legal Luminary emphasized that only the University Governing Council that is bestowed with such Powers under Universities Miscellaneous Provisions Act 2012 as (Amended).
According to him, “Am a lawyer and the truth is that ASUU lacks the power under the Nigerian Trade Union laws to sanction the Management of Federal University of Technology (FUTO) over the supposed infraction”
“ASUU is ignorant of the facts and this is worrisome, there is nowhere under the Trade Union (Amendment) Act 2005 (which is the legislation guiding the operations of all Trade Unions in Nigeria,including ASUU), that gives ASUU the power to sanction a University Management for a supposed infraction.
“And the law guiding the affairs of all Federal Universities in Nigeria is the Universities (Miscellaneous Provisions)(Amendment) Act 2012.
“Under this law, University Management can only be sanctioned by its Governing Council not ASUU”, he explained.
Barrister Agboti further called on the leadership of ASUU to redress it’s step or face litigation, insisting that ASUU was stepping out of its scope.
It would be recalled that the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) had on Monday described the Professorship conferred by the institution to the Minister as illegal.
The Union threatened to sanction its members including the Vice-Chancellor of the Federal University of Technology, Owerri and other senior Management Staffs of the institution
